Everything You Need to Know About Rectangular Prism Calculations

A rectangular prism, also known as a cuboid, is one of the most fundamental three-dimensional shapes in geometry. It shows up everywhere: shipping boxes, rooms in a building, swimming pools, aquariums, storage containers, and concrete foundations. Volume: How Much Space Is Inside?

The volume of a rectangular prism is calculated by multiplying its three dimensions: Volume = length x width x height. This tells you the total space enclosed within the shape. Practical applications are everywhere. Need to know how much soil fills a raised garden bed that's 8 feet long, 4 feet wide, and 1.5 feet deep? That's 48 cubic feet. Ordering concrete for a patio slab? The volume calculation tells you exactly how many cubic yards to order. Surface Area: How Much Material to Cover It?

The total surface area formula is SA = 2(lw + lh + wh), where l, w, and h represent length, width, and height respectively. This calculation answers questions like: how much wrapping paper do I need for this gift box? How many square feet of paint will cover the outside of a storage shed? How much sheet metal is required to fabricate a duct section? Space Diagonal: The Longest Internal Distance

The space diagonal runs from one corner of the prism to the opposite corner, cutting through the interior. Its formula is d = square root of (l squared + w squared + h squared), which is the three-dimensional extension of the Pythagorean theorem. This measurement matters when you need to know if a long object, like a fishing rod, pool cue, or poster tube, will fit diagonally inside a box. If your box is 36 x 24 x 18 inches, the space diagonal is about 46.5 inches, meaning anything shorter than that will fit inside.

Lateral Surface Area: Just the Sides

Sometimes you only care about the four side faces, not the top and bottom. The lateral surface area formula is LSA = 2h(l + w). This is useful for calculating wall area in a room (excluding floor and ceiling), the amount of material for a sleeve or wrapper that leaves the ends open, or the surface area of a tank's vertical walls. Real-World Applications Across Industries

Construction professionals use rectangular prism calculations daily for estimating concrete, drywall, and flooring quantities. Shipping and logistics teams calculate box volumes to determine how many units fit in a container. Aquarium enthusiasts compute tank volume to ensure proper water filtration capacity and fish stocking density. HVAC engineers calculate ductwork dimensions and airflow capacities. Students use these formulas throughout geometry and physics courses, making this calculator a reliable homework companion.
